Rajupalem Village Map

The Rajupalem village is located in the state Andhra Pradesh having state code 28 and having the village code 590040. The Guntur is the district of this village with district code 548. The total geographical area in which this village is expanded in 1178 hectares / 11.78 Square Kilometers (km2) / 2910.9013936833 acres. Location Details

The Rajupalem village is situated in the Guntur district with district code number 548. Rajupalem is the subdistrict (tehsil / mandal), is a low-level administrative division of a district, of this village, having the sub district code is 05059. Rajupalem is the Community Development Block (C.D. Block) of this village with C.D. Block code number 0727. The gram panchayat for this village is Rajupalem, Brahmanapalle. Rajupalem is the Sub-district headquarter of this village. The district headquarters' name is Guntur and as per distance concern it is 48 kilometres from the Rajupalem village.

Nearest Towns / Cities

Piduguralla is the nearest statutory town of the village Rajupalem, which is 12 kilometres away from the village. Piduguralla is the nearest statutory town of this village lies within the state of Andhra Pradesh and situated with the distance 12 kilometres away from village.

Rajupalem Households and Populations



The total number of households in Rajupalem village are 1015. It rely on the total population of 4139 people. As far as male population concern the number of population is 2091 of the village Rajupalem and the total female population number is 2048. The reference taken to publish these data is of year 2009. The source of data is Census of India.
